Child Psychiatry: Focus on Resilience for Kids
Child psychiatry emphasizes the development of resilience in children facing mental health challenges. By fostering a supportive environment, mental health professionals help children build the skills necessary to navigate emotional and psychological hurdles effectively. This approach not only addresses immediate issues but also equips children with lifelong coping mechanisms. Techniques such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) are tailored to younger patients to help them understand and manage their emotions in a healthy way.

Trauma Recovery: Managing Nightmares and Triggers
Trauma recovery focuses on helping individuals manage and overcome the distressing symptoms associated with traumatic experiences, such as nightmares and triggers. Therapists employ techniques like exposure therapy, E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ing), and trauma-focused cognitive behavioral therapy to help patients process their trauma in a safe and controlled environment, aiming to reduce the impact of these symptoms on daily life.
Treating Anxiety Disorders: Breath-Driven Recovery Plans
Treating anxiety disorders often involves breath-driven recovery plans, which utilize breathing techniques to help soothe the nervous system. These methods, including diaphragmatic breathing and paced respiration, are taught by therapists as part of a broader cognitive-behavioral approach. By mastering these techniques, patients can gain immediate relief during anxiety attacks and gradually reduce their overall anxiety levels.

Sleep Disorder Treatment: Peaceful Rest Through Structure
Sleep disorder treatment focuses on establishing a structured routine to encourage peaceful rest. Sleep hygiene practices, such as setting a consistent bedtime, creating a comfortable sleep environment, and limiting exposure to screens before bed, are often recommended. For more severe cases, c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) may be used to address the underlying thoughts and behaviors disrupting sleep.

Managing OCD: Professional OCD Assessments
Managing OCD involves professional assessments to accurately diagnose and gauge the severity of the condition. Specialized therapists use these assessments to tailor treatment plans that may include exposure and response prevention (ERP), a form of cognitive-behavioral therapy specifically effective for OCD. This targeted approach helps reduce compulsive behaviors and obsessive thoughts.

Do I need a referral to see a psychiatrist in Virginia Key?
It depends on your health insurance plan. Some plans require a referral from a primary care provider to see a psychiatrist while others allow you to make an appointment directly. Be sure to check your specific health plan details.
Can psychiatrists in Virginia Key prescribe medication?
Yes, psychiatrists are medical doctors who have received specialized training in psychiatry, which qualifies them to prescribe and manage medication for mental health concerns.
What should I expect during my first appointment with a psychiatrist in Virginia Key?
During your first appointment, the psychiatrist will typically conduct a comprehensive psychiatric evaluation. This may involve discussing your mental and physical health history, current symptoms, and any medications you are taking. The goal is to formulate a diagnosis and develop a treatment plan tailored specifically for you.
